If you've been trying out Apple's Arcade or News+ subscription, TV apps, like STARZ or HBO GO, or music subscription services like Pandora Premium, but you want to cancel before you get charged, it's simple to cancel in just a few steps.
How to cancel an App Store or News+ subscription on iPhone or iPad
- Launch the Settings app.
- Tap iTunes & App Store.
-
Tap on your Apple ID.
- Tap View Apple ID when the pop up window appears.
- Enter your Apple ID password, Face ID, or Touch ID when prompted.
-
Tap Subscriptions.
- Tap the Subscription you want to cancel.
- Tap Cancel Subscription.
-
Tap Confirm when prompted to confirm that you want to cancel your subscription.
After your current period ends, whether it is part of a free trial or a regular recurring subscription, iTunes will no longer bill you for that subscription.
Note: News+ and Apple Arcade trial subscriptions end as soon as you cancel the subscription. There is no grace period.
How to cancel an App Store or News+ subscription on your Mac
You can manage your subscriptions right on your Mac from the Mac App Store.
- Open the App Store on your Mac.
- Click on your Profile in the bottom-left corner of the App Store window.
-
Click on View Information in the upper-right corner of the App Store window.
- Click on Manage under the Subscriptions section.
-
Click on Edit next to the subscription you want to cancel.
- Click on Cancel Subscription.
-
Click on Done.
How to cancel an App Store or News+ subscription on Apple TV
- Go to the Settings app on your Apple TV.
- Select Accounts > Manage Subscriptions.
- Choose the subscription in question.
- Press Cancel Subscription.
- Confirm the cancellation.
